Renovating a Condo in Vancouver: Understanding Local Guidelines
Renovating a condo in Vancouver usually requires navigating a combination of strata bylaws, city regulations, and provincial standards. Unlike renovating a single-family home, condos are governed by stricter rules that help protect shared building infrastructure and maintain a consistent appearance. Before you begin your project, make sure you review your strata council's policies and the relevant municipal permit requirements.
Strata bylaws can vary significantly between buildings, so it is essential to understand if you are permitted to modify load-bearing walls, plumbing lines, or electrical systems. Even seemingly minor cosmetic upgrades, such as installing new flooring, may need approval to ensure soundproofing requirements are met. These rules exist to protect all residents and preserve the property's overall condition. On a city level, you may need to apply for permits if you are making substantial changes. The City of Vancouver has specific guidelines on structural updates, building envelopes, and fire safety that must be upheld. These rules are designed to ensure both safety and sustainability in multi-unit dwellings. If you are unsure whether your project needs a permit, you can check municipal resources or consult a trusted contractor. By clarifying expectations up front, you reduce the risk of costly violations.
Beyond permits, it is important to remain mindful of noise bylaws and designated work hours. Many strata councils enforce quiet times to minimize disruption to neighbors. Communicate with your property management or strata board to schedule your renovation in a way that respects these regulations. Timely and transparent communication is an excellent way to maintain a positive relationship with the condo community.
